- juliof917 (10/5): Little Big Jewel Hotel in Antigua - A small hotel that belong to Hoteles Posada de San carlos.
This little hotel has small very comfortable basic rooms, each of them with private bathroom.
It has a kitchen facility that can be used for the guests to prepare meals if they want to save money in restaurants and traveling in a budget.
Located 5 steps from La Bodegona , a amazing humongous convinience store where you can find all you need for your trip.
Hotel has 9 rooms, they are very clean, beds are comfortable, restrooms with towels provided and soap dispenser at the shower, TV with cable, very cozy ambiance.
My second visit to this one.
Hazel the ownwer made sure I felt at home. She always listen and solve inmediately any issue related to the acommodation.
Location is just 2 blocks and a half from Parque Central ( central park).
THE PRICE IS GREAT.
This hotel has the basic for the traveler no fancy , but family atmosphere. The staff is always smiling and prompt to help.
There is a massage service for a great price. ( they have a list of special massages and facials!!!)
Tours can be arranged for you if you need one.
I really love this one.
